#1d6eaf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#1d6eaf is composed of 11.4% red, 43.1% green and 68.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 83.4% cyan, 37.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 31.4% black. It has a hue angle of 206.7 degrees, a saturation of 71.6% and a lightness of 40%. #1d6eaf color hex could be obtained by blending #3adcff with #00005f. Closest websafe color is: #336699.

#1d6eaf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#1d6eaf has RGB values of R:29, G:110, B:175 and CMYK values of C:0.83, M:0.37, Y:0, K:0.31. Its decimal value is 1928879.

Hex triplet 1d6eaf #1d6eaf
RGB Decimal 29, 110, 175 rgb(29,110,175)
RGB Percent 11.4, 43.1, 68.6 rgb(11.4%,43.1%,68.6%)
CMYK 83, 37, 0, 31
HSL 206.7°, 71.6, 40 hsl(206.7,71.6%,40%)
HSV (or HSB) 206.7°, 83.4, 68.6
Web Safe 336699 #336699
CIE-LAB 44.951, 0.191, -41.22
XYZ 13.819, 14.507, 42.627
xyY 0.195, 0.204, 14.507
CIE-LCH 44.951, 41.221, 270.266
CIE-LUV 44.951, -25.713, -61.335
Hunter-Lab 38.088, -1.893, -39.694
Binary 00011101, 01101110, 10101111

Shades and Tints of #1d6eaf

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010407 is the darkest color, while #f5fafd is the lightest one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#1d6eaf is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#5d5d5d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#50606d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#5770ae Protanopia 1% of men
  • #4172b4 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#007d85 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#426fae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#3471b2 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#0a7794 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
